Job Title Staff Synthetic Chemist Requisition JR000014030 Staff Synthetic Chemist (Open) Location St. Louis, MO (Pharma) - USA032 Additional Locations St. Louis, MO Job Description Job Summary To support the expansion of small molecule API R&D development capabilities within Mallinckrodt’s Specialty Generics business, this new position within the API Development and Support organization will be responsible for development of new API chemical processes. Essential Functions: Works in a fast-paced, results-oriented team environment to provide creative solutions to drive new API development. Identifies route selections for target API molecules amenable to fast and efficient scale-up to commercial production. Possesses knowledge and skillset base to develop and scale-up commercially viable, safe, environmentally friendly, and robust API chemical processes. Interacts effectively with Manufacturing, Engineering, Safety organizations as well as other members of the API development team. Familiar with DOE and QbD techniques to create optimal API manufacturing processes. Possesses an understanding of engineering principles as it relates to target molecule route selection and development. Provides excellent understanding of FDA Q7A GMP principles and requirements for successful regulatory filings. Performs assigned tasks using own discretion and judgment as to the specific approach or technique. Demonstrates knowledge in scientific techniques, theory, troubleshooting, etc. Demonstrates excellent verbal and written communication skills. Remains compliant with company, site, and safety policies and procedures. Must be able to work with controlled substances. Department Specific / Non-Essential Function: Familiarity with the following preferred: Latest pharmaceutical process chemistry and technologies Process analytical technology (PAT) FDA Q7A Good Manufacturing Practice Guidance for API’s ICH guidelines Requirements of various pharmacopeias (USP, EP, JP) Controlled substance handling Minimum Requirements: Education/Experience: BS in Chemistry with at least 8 years of relevant API development experience. MS (thesis preferred) with at least 5 years of relevant API development experience. PhD in Chemistry with at least 3 years of relevant API development experience. Preferred Skills/Qualifications: Solid organic synthesis knowledge and understanding of the fundamental aspects of complex chemistries and processes. Considerable hands-on experience with route selection, process development, validation, and commercial technical transfer is required. Experience with unit operations and ability to effectively interact with manufacturing chemical engineers. Proven ability and desire to solve technically complex problems. Knowledgeable in cGMP and FDA guidelines. Experience in analytical techniques such as IR, MS, NMR, and HPLC. Skills/Competencies: Self-starter with strong work ethic, excellent written and verbal communication skills, the ability to successfully direct or manage various projects and to contribute / facilitate team investigations. Demonstrated ability to work well in a fast-paced team setting, especially in a resource limited environment. Must be able to contribute to projects and operate with limited supervision. Relationship with Others: Interaction with other API Development and Support team members is common. May collaborate on joint projects. Will interact, from time to time with manufacturing plant leaders/managers. Working Conditions: Typical laboratory conditions. Employees are required to wear eye protection and lab coats while in the lab area. Occasional handling of potent compounds or hazardous chemicals may require the use of additional PPE. Drug Enforcement Administration (DEA) regulated workplace. The employee occasionally lifts and/or moves up to 25 lbs. Mallinckrodt is a global specialty pharmaceutical business that develops, manufactures, markets and distributes specialty pharmaceutical products. Areas of focus include therapeutic drugs for autoimmune and rare disease specialty areas like neurology, rheumatology, nephrology, ophthalmology and pulmonology; immunotherapy and neonatal respiratory critical care therapies; and analgesics and central nervous system drugs. The company's core strengths include the acquisition and management of highly regulated raw materials; deep regulatory expertise; and specialized chemistry, formulation and manufacturing capabilities. The company's Specialty Brands segment includes branded medicines; its Specialty Generics segment includes specialty generic drugs, active pharmaceutical ingredients and external manufacturing.
